Sobriety isn't just the absence of addiction; it's a journey of renewal. It requires resolve, but the rewards are immeasurable. This guide offers guidance to help you navigate the path to lasting sobriety, one step at a time.
Finding a group of people who understand your struggles can be incredibly beneficial. Sharing your experiences and learning from others who have walked a similar road can provide invaluable strength.
- Consider local support groups like Alcoholics Anonymous or Narcotics Anonymous. These organizations offer organized meetings where you can connect with others in recovery.
- Engage therapy sessions to gain awareness into your actions. A therapist can provide personalized support and help you develop coping mechanisms for challenging situations.
- Emphasize self-care practices that nourish your physical well-being. This could include exercise, healthy eating, meditation, or spending time in nature.
Crucial Resources for Sobriety and Well-being
Embarking on the journey of addiction recovery is a courageous endeavor that necessitates unwavering commitment and support. While professional guidance plays a vital role, there are essential tools that aid individuals in their pursuit of lasting well-being. Establishing a strong support system is paramount, featuring loved ones, support groups, and mental health professionals who offer steadfast encouragement and understanding. Engaging in therapy sessions provides a safe space to explore underlying issues and develop healthy coping mechanisms. Mindfulness practices, such as meditation and yoga, can help cultivate inner calm, reducing stress and enhancing emotional regulation. Furthermore, incorporating a healthy lifestyle with regular exercise, balanced eating habits, and adequate sleep can significantly contribute to overall recovery. Remember, addiction recovery is a continuous process, and these tools can provide invaluable assistance along the way.
